Over 200 People Are Killed By The “World’s Deadliest Food” Every Year, But Almost 500 Million People Still Eat It

It may sound shocking, but one of the world’s most widely consumed foods is also considered one of the deadliest. Every year, more than 200 people lose their lives due to eating it incorrectly, yet nearly 500 million people continue to rely on it as a daily staple. This food is cassava, a root vegetable that plays a major role in diets across Africa, Asia, and Latin America.

Cassava is popular because it is affordable, easy to grow, and highly resistant to harsh conditions like drought. For many communities, it is not just a food choice—it is a necessity for survival. However, what makes it dangerous is the presence of natural compounds called cyanogenic glucosides, which can release cyanide if the plant is not prepared properly.

When consumed raw or poorly processed, cassava can lead to serious poisoning, causing symptoms like dizziness, paralysis, and even death. The risk is especially high in regions facing poverty or food shortages, where proper preparation methods may not always be followed. In some cases, it has even been linked to a neurological condition known as konzo, which causes irreversible damage to the body.

Despite these dangers, cassava is safe when handled correctly. Traditional preparation methods such as soaking, drying, fermenting, and thorough cooking help remove the harmful toxins. This turns it into a valuable and nutritious food source. In the end, the real danger is not the food itself, but how it is prepared—proving that knowledge and care can make all the difference.
